Tuscarora Almanac - December 4, 1938 - The Book of Last Runs

This is the last day of service on the 6th Avenue El. The last southbound train left 155th Street at 10:06 PM with a seven car consist and many last riders. The last northbound train left Rector Street at 10:50 PM and arrived at 155th Street at 11:18 PM stopping only at 42nd Street and 53rd Street.

Service was discontinued between 59th Street - 9th Avenue and South Ferry. The following stations were closed; 8th Avenue-53rd Street, 50th Street, 42nd Street, 38th Street, 33rd Street, 28th Street, 23rd Street, 18th Street, 14th Street, 8th Street, Bleecker Street, Grand Street, Franklin Street, Chambers Street, Park Place, Cortlandt Street and Rector Street. The stations at Battery Place and South Ferry which are actually on the 9th Avenue El will continue to be served by those trains.

Source: New York Division Bulletin /December 1993



Tuscarora Almanac - December 4, 2001 - The Book of First Runs

The first train of R-143 cars enters test service on the "L" 14th Street - Canarsie Line. The consist is 8101-04 and 8105-08.

Source: New York Division Bulletin / January 2002
